Ephraim’s Captivity Predicted

28 Woe to the proud crown of the (A)drunkards of (B)Ephraim,
And to the fading flower of its glorious beauty,
Which is at the head of the [a]fertile valley
Of those who are [b]overcome with wine!
Behold, the Lord has a strong and (C)mighty agent;
As a storm of (D)hail, a tempest of destruction,
Like a storm of (E)mighty overflowing waters,
He has cast it down to the earth with His hand.
The proud crown of the drunkards of Ephraim is (F)trodden under foot.
And the fading flower of its glorious beauty,
Which is at the head of the [c]fertile valley,
Will be like the (G)first-ripe fig prior to summer,
Which [d]one sees,
And [e]as soon as it is in his [f]hand,
He swallows it.
In that day the (H)Lord of hosts will become a beautiful (I)crown
And a glorious diadem to the remnant of His people;
A (J)spirit of justice for him who sits in judgment,
A (K)strength to those who repel the [g]onslaught at the gate.
And these also (L)reel with wine and stagger from strong drink:
(M)The priest and (N)the prophet reel with strong drink,
They are confused by wine, they stagger from (O)strong drink;
They reel while [h]having (P)visions,
They totter when rendering judgment.
For all the tables are full of filthy (Q)vomit, without a single clean place.

“To (R)whom would He teach knowledge,
And to whom would He interpret the message?
Those just (S)weaned from milk?
Those just taken from the breast?
10 “For He says,
[i](T)Order on order, order on order,
Line on line, line on line,
A little here, a little there.’”
11 Indeed, He will speak to this people
Through (U)stammering lips and a foreign tongue,
12 He who said to them, “Here is (V)rest, give rest to the weary,”
And, “Here is repose,” but they would not listen.
13 So the word of the Lord to them will be,
[j]Order on order, order on order,
Line on line, line on line,
A little here, a little there,”
That they may go and (W)stumble backward, be broken, snared and taken captive.

Judah Is Warned

14 Therefore, (X)hear the word of the Lord, O (Y)scoffers,
Who rule this people who are in Jerusalem,
15 Because you have said, “We have made a (Z)covenant with death,
And with [k]Sheol we have made a [l]pact.
(AA)The overwhelming [m]scourge will not reach us when it passes by,
For we have made (AB)falsehood our refuge and we have (AC)concealed ourselves with deception.”

16 Therefore thus says the Lord [n]God,

(AD)Behold, I am laying in Zion a stone, a tested (AE)stone,
A costly cornerstone for the foundation, [o]firmly placed.
He who believes in it will not be [p]disturbed.
17 “I will make (AF)justice the measuring line
And righteousness the level;
Then (AG)hail will sweep away the refuge of lies
And the waters will overflow the secret place.
18 “Your (AH)covenant with death will be [q](AI)canceled,
And your pact with Sheol will not stand;
When the (AJ)overwhelming scourge passes through,
Then you become its (AK)trampling place.
19 “As (AL)often as it passes through, it will [r]seize you;
For (AM)morning after morning it will pass through, anytime during the day or night,
And it will be [s]sheer (AN)terror to understand [t]what it means.”
20 The bed is too short on which to stretch out,
And the (AO)blanket is too [u]small to wrap oneself in.
21 For the Lord will rise up as at Mount (AP)Perazim,
He will be stirred up as in the valley of (AQ)Gibeon,
To do His (AR)task, His [v](AS)unusual task,
And to work His work, His [w]extraordinary work.
22 And now do not carry on as (AT)scoffers,
Or your fetters will be made stronger;
For I have heard from the Lord [x]God of hosts
Of decisive (AU)destruction on all the earth.

23 Give ear and hear my voice,
Listen and hear my words.
24 Does the [y]farmer plow [z]continually to plant seed?
Does he continually [aa]turn and harrow the ground?
25 Does he not level its surface
And sow dill and scatter (AV)cummin
And [ab]plant (AW)wheat in rows,
Barley in its place and rye within its [ac]area?
26 For his God instructs and teaches him properly.
27 For dill is not threshed with a (AX)threshing sledge,
Nor is the cartwheel [ad]driven over cummin;
But dill is beaten out with a rod, and cummin with a club.
28 Grain for bread is crushed,
Indeed, he does not continue to thresh it forever.
Because the wheel of his cart and his horses eventually [ae]damage it,
He does not thresh it longer.
29 This also comes from the Lord of hosts,
Who has made His counsel (AY)wonderful and His wisdom (AZ)great.

Jerusalem Is Warned

29 Woe, O [af]Ariel, [ag]Ariel the city where David once (BA)camped!
Add year to year, [ah](BB)observe your feasts on schedule.
I will bring distress to Ariel,
And she will be a city of lamenting and (BC)mourning;
And she will be like an Ariel to me.
I will (BD)camp against you [ai]encircling you,
And I will set siegeworks against you,
And I will raise up battle towers against you.
Then you will (BE)be brought low;
From the earth you will speak,
And from the dust where you are prostrate
Your words will come.
Your voice will also be like that of a [aj]spirit from the ground,
And your speech will whisper from the dust.

But the multitude of your [ak]enemies will become like fine (BF)dust,
And the multitude of the (BG)ruthless ones like the chaff which [al]blows away;
And it will happen (BH)instantly, suddenly.
From the Lord of hosts you will be (BI)punished with (BJ)thunder and earthquake and loud noise,
With whirlwind and tempest and the flame of a consuming fire.
And the (BK)multitude of all the nations who wage war against [am]Ariel,
Even all who wage war against her and her stronghold, and who distress her,
Will be like a dream, a (BL)vision of the night.
It will be as when a hungry man dreams—
And behold, he is eating;
But when he awakens, his [an]hunger is not satisfied,
Or as when a thirsty man dreams—
And behold, he is drinking,
But when he awakens, behold, he is faint
And his [ao]thirst is not quenched.
(BM)Thus the multitude of all the nations will be
Who wage war against Mount Zion.

(BN)Be delayed and wait,
Blind yourselves and be blind;
They (BO)become drunk, but not with wine,
They stagger, but not with strong drink.
10 For the Lord has poured over you a spirit of deep (BP)sleep,
He has (BQ)shut your eyes, the prophets;
And He has covered your heads, the seers.

11 The entire vision will be to you like the words of a sealed [ap](BR)book, which when they give it to the one who [aq]is literate, saying, “Please read this,” he will say, “I cannot, for it is sealed.” 12 Then the [ar]book will be given to the one who [as]is illiterate, saying, “Please read this.” And he will say, “I [at]cannot read.”

13 Then the Lord said,

“Because (BS)this people draw near with their [au]words
And honor Me with their [av]lip service,
But they remove their hearts far from Me,
And their [aw]reverence for Me [ax]consists of [ay]tradition learned by rote,
14 Therefore behold, I will once again deal (BT)marvelously with this people, wondrously marvelous;
And (BU)the wisdom of their wise men will perish,
And the discernment of their discerning men will be concealed.”

15 Woe to those who deeply (BV)hide their [az]plans from the Lord,
And whose (BW)deeds are done in a dark place,
And they say, “(BX)Who sees us?” or “Who knows us?”
16 You turn things around!
Shall the potter be considered [ba]as equal with the clay,
That (BY)what is made would say to its maker, “He did not make me”;
Or what is formed say to him who formed it, “He has no understanding”?

Blessing after Discipline

17 Is it not yet just a little while
[bb]Before Lebanon will be turned into a (BZ)fertile field,
And the fertile field will be considered as a forest?
18 On that day the (CA)deaf will hear (CB)words of a book,
And out of their gloom and darkness the (CC)eyes of the blind will see.
19 The (CD)afflicted also will increase their gladness in the Lord,
And the (CE)needy of mankind will rejoice in the Holy One of Israel.
20 For the (CF)ruthless will come to an end and the (CG)scorner will be finished,
Indeed (CH)all who [bc]are intent on doing evil will be cut off;
21 Who [bd]cause a person to be indicted by a word,
And (CI)ensnare him who adjudicates at the gate,
And [be](CJ)defraud the one in the right with [bf]meaningless arguments.

22 Therefore thus says the Lord, who redeemed (CK)Abraham, concerning the house of Jacob:

“Jacob (CL)shall not now be ashamed, nor shall his face now turn pale;
23 But when [bg]he sees his (CM)children, the (CN)work of My hands, in his midst,
They will sanctify My name;
Indeed, they will (CO)sanctify the Holy One of Jacob
And will stand in awe of the God of Israel.
24 “Those who (CP)err in [bh]mind will (CQ)know [bi]the truth,
And those who [bj]criticize will [bk](CR)accept instruction.
